#8131f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8131f2 is composed of 50.6% red, 19.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 57.1%. #8131f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#0300e5.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#8131f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8131f2 has RGB values of R:129, G:49,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8466930.

Shades and Tints of #8131f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8131f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918e95 is the less saturated color, while #8029fa is the most saturated one.
